Sami van Ingen
Born in 1964, Sami van Ingen is a veteran in alternative Finnish film, where he has worked as an artist, lecturer and curator, since the late 1980s. He lives and works in Helsinki, Finland. Van Ingen finished his doctoral studies in the Academy of Fine Arts, at the University of Arts in Helsinki/ “Taideyliopiston Kuvataideakatemia”, in 2012. He often uses random or found materials, in his works. His works have been seen in many national and international exhibitions and festivals, over the years, including Tbilisi International Triennial/ “თბილისის საერთაშორისო ტრიენალე” (2012), at Kunsthalle Helsinki/ “Helsingin Taidehalli” (2005), and at “Sara Hildén” Art Museum/ “Sara Hildénin taidemuseo” in Tampere, Finland (2002).
